**Ticket: Memory leak in Pixelbin image cache**

The Pixelbin thumbnail cache grows unbounded under sustained load; eviction never fires when TTL and size limits conflict. Fix swaps the eviction policy to strict LRU and adds a heap watermark alarm. Staging shows flat memory over 48 hours. Ready to merge pending sign-off at the weekly sync from the engineer below.

account owner for bawip-tahag: Raleth Quenok

## Authentication

Bigdiff requires auth for any file over 50 MB. Requests go through the internal Chunkgate service; unauthenticated calls get a 401. Tokens are scoped per repo and expire daily—don't cache them. Local dev uses the shared staging credential. Set the environment variable to the key below.

app token of fafog-badug = kto4_gEXd

For external plugin authors only. Veilstone rotates secrets for plugin sandboxes on a 12-hour cycle. Normal flow: request rotation via the plugin console; never embed secrets in plugin code. Break-glass applies only when the rotation API is down and your plugin's credentials have expired mid-cycle. Open the break-glass panel, state the outage ticket in the reason field, and accept the audit prompt. Access is logged and reviewed by the Hollis platform team. At the final prompt, supply the passphrase below.

recovery phrase for bawep-kawef: oliath-casdor